“…The reaction temperature is then adjusted to allow primer annealing, typically within 37 °C to 65 °C. Successful primer annealing precedes the addition of a helicase enzyme, crucial for initiating the unwinding of the DNA duplex by recognizing the annealed primers, action which leads to strand separation, exposing single-strand regions ready for processing ( Lee et al, 2022a , Moon et al, 2022 ). Following DNA duplex unwinding, DNA polymerase is introduced, triggering DNA synthesis by extending from the primers, utilizing single-strand DNA as templates.…”

“…HDA has been adapted for colorimetric, fluorescent and lateral flow read-outs, making it applicable to POC and in-field applications [ 61 ]. HDA has been used to detect a large number of human and animal pathogens, including Norovirus [ 62 ], SARS-CoV-2 [ 63 ], M. tuberculosis [ 64 ], T. vaginalis [ 65 ] and yellow fever virus in a resource-limited setting [ 66 ].…”
